Summary
Dirac is a productivity tool that aggregates updates from various applications (like Discord, email, GitHub, etc.) and condenses them into a 30-second summary, allowing users to start their day with full context without spending time switching between tabs. The tool aims to help users avoid manual context-gathering and wasted time, focusing initially on messaging/email catch-up but planning to expand to data, project management, and development/coding sectors.
